解决Hyper-V虚拟网卡残留问题
hyper-v虚拟网卡残留

首页 2025-01-12 06:13:54



Hyper-V虚拟网卡残留:问题与解决方案的深度剖析 在现代企业计算环境中,虚拟化技术已经成为不可或缺的一部分

    微软公司的Hyper-V作为其中一种领先的虚拟化平台,为众多企业提供了高效、灵活的虚拟化解决方案

    然而,随着Hyper-V的广泛应用,一些技术挑战也随之而来,其中最常见的问题之一就是Hyper-V虚拟网卡残留

    本文将深入探讨这一问题,并提供详尽的解决方案,帮助企业IT管理员有效应对这一技术难题

     一、Hyper-V虚拟网卡残留的问题背景 Hyper-V是微软开发的虚拟化平台,允许用户在同一物理硬件上运行多个操作系统

    在Hyper-V环境中,虚拟网卡是连接虚拟机与外部网络的重要组件

    虚拟网卡不仅提供了虚拟机之间的网络通信,还实现了虚拟机与外部物理网络的连接

    然而,当虚拟机被删除或迁移时,有时会出现虚拟网卡残留的问题

     虚拟网卡残留通常发生在以下几种情况: 1.虚拟机未彻底删除:如果在删除虚拟机时没有按照正确步骤操作,可能会导致虚拟网卡残留在系统中

     2.底层虚拟化平台操作:有时,IT管理员可能会直接在底层的虚拟化平台(如Hyper-V管理器)上删除虚拟网卡,而不是通过大云管理平台(如CloudOS)进行操作,这也会导致虚拟网卡残留

     3.卸载虚拟机时未清理注册表:注册表是Windows操作系统中用于存储配置信息的数据库

    如果卸载虚拟机时没有清理注册表中的相关信息,也可能导致虚拟网卡残留

     二、Hyper-V虚拟网卡残留的危害 虚拟网卡残留不仅会影响系统的稳定性和性能,还可能带来一系列安全隐患

    具体来说,虚拟网卡残留的危害包括以下几个方面: 1.系统资源占用:残留的虚拟网卡会占用系统资源,如内存和CPU,导致系统性能下降

     2.网络冲突:残留的虚拟网卡可能会导致网络冲突,如IP地址冲突、MAC地址冲突等,影响网络的正常通信

     3.安全隐患:残留的虚拟网卡可能成为黑客攻击的入口,增加系统的安全风险

     4.管理混乱:虚拟网卡残留会导致系统管理混乱,难以准确追踪和管理虚拟网络资源

     三、Hyper-V虚拟网卡残留的解决方案 针对Hyper-V虚拟网卡残留的问题,本文提供以下几种解决方案: 1. 彻底删除虚拟机 在删除虚拟机时,必须确保按照正确的步骤进行操作,以避免虚拟网卡残留

    具体来说,可以按照以下步骤进行: 1.停止虚拟机:在Hyper-V管理器中,右键点击要删除的虚拟机,选择“关闭”或“强制关闭”以停止虚拟机运行

     2.删除虚拟机:右键点击已停止的虚拟机,选择“删除”选项

    在弹出的对话框中,确认要删除虚拟机及其所有相关文件

     3.清理注册表:使用注册表编辑器(regedit)清理与虚拟机相关的注册表项

    注意,在修改注册表前,最好先备份注册表,以防出现意外情况

     2. 通过大云管理平台删除虚拟网卡 在有大云的环境中,对云资源(包括虚拟机、云硬盘、虚拟网卡等)的增删改等操作应该在大云管理平台上进行,而不是直接在底层的虚拟化平台或控制器上操作

    这样可以避免虚拟网卡残留的问题

     如果虚拟网卡已经残留,可以通过以下步骤在大云管理平台上进行删除: 1.确认虚拟网卡信息:登录大云管理平台,确认需要删除的虚拟网卡的IP地址和相关信息

     2.进入容器:根据大云管理平台的类型(如CloudOS2.0/3.0/5.0),进入相应的容器(如openstack容器或neutron容器)

     3.执行删除命令:在容器内部执行相应的命令(如neutron port-delete),根据虚拟网卡的IP地址或ID删除该虚拟网卡

     4.清理残留信息:删除虚拟网卡后,清理浏览器缓存并重新登录大云管理平台,确认虚拟网卡已被彻底删除

    同时,在vcfc上检查vport是否还存在,如果存在,则手动删除之

     3. 禁用并卸载异常的网络适配器 在某些情况下,虚拟网卡残留可能是由于使用了Hyper-V的桥接网络模式导致的

    在桥接网络模式下,Hyper-V会创建一个虚拟交换机,并将虚拟机的网络流量通过该交换机转发到物理网络上

    如果虚拟机被删除,但桥接连接未正确清理,可能会导致虚拟网卡残留

     针对这种情况,可以尝试禁用并卸载异常的网络适配器来解决虚拟网卡残留的问题

    具体操作步骤如下: 1.禁用Hyper-V:在控制面板中打开“程序和功能”,点击“启用或关闭Windows功能”,找到并取消勾选“Hyper-V”选项,然后重启电脑

     2.卸载异常网络适配器:在电脑重启后,打开设备管理器,找到并卸载所有异常的网络适配器(如VEthernet适配器)

     3.清理注册表:使用注册表编辑器清理与异常网络适配器相关的注册表项

     需要注意的是,禁用Hyper-V并卸载异常网络适配器会导致现有虚拟机无法使用

    因此,在执行此操作前,请确保已经备份了所有重要的虚拟机数据和配置文件

     4. 定期检查和维护 为了避免虚拟网卡残留的问题,建议IT管理员定期对Hyper-V环境进行检查和维护

    具体来说,可以采取以下措施: 1.定期检查虚拟机状态:定期检查虚拟机的运行状态和配置文件,确保所有虚拟机都正常运行且配置正确

     2.定期清理无用资源:定期清理无用的虚拟机、虚拟硬盘和虚拟网卡等资源,避免资源占用和冲突

     3.定期更新和升级:定期更新和升级Hyper-V平台和相关的管理软件,以确保系统的安全性和稳定性

     四、总结与展望 Hyper-V虚拟网卡残留是一个常见的技术问题,但通过正确的操作方法和维护策略,可以有效避免和解决这一问题

    本文深入探讨了Hyper-V虚拟网卡残留的问题背景、危害以及解决方案,并提供了详细的操作步骤和注意事项

    希望本文能够帮助企业IT管理员更好地理解和应对Hyper-V虚拟网卡残留的问题

     未来,随着虚拟化技术的不断发展和完善,相信Hyper-V平台将提供更加稳定和高效的虚拟化解决方案

    同时,也期待微软公司能够不断优化和完善Hyper-V平台的功能和性能,为企业用户提供更加优质的虚拟化服务

     总之,面对Hyper-V虚拟网卡残留的问题,企业IT管理员应该保持冷静和耐心,按照正确的步骤进行操作,并加强系统的定期检查和维护工作

    只有这样,才能确保Hyper-V环境的稳定性和安全性,为企业的业务发展提供有力的技术支持

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道